We all know how hard teachers work, so why not give them a extra special little treat during teacher appreciation week. I’m sharing a teacher appreciation day treat that I “snuck” into our teachers lounge last year.
This is a super quick an easy way to say thank you to all of our teachers and co-workers. I thought ice cream would be a perfect treat since we’re in the 100’s here in Arizona by the first week in May. I went to the grocery store and purchased five boxes of Blue Bunny ice cream cones and sandwiches. (They were on sale 5 boxes for $10, yay!) I put them into our freezers (we’re lucky to have two refrigerators in our lounge) I made up this cute sign to let everyone know where to find their special treats and placed it on the table.
Everyone truly appreciated it and I was still hearing about it over the next couple of weeks. Something small like this can go along way!
